SamFw Tool 4.9 — Samsung FRP Removal
DESCRIPTION:
The SamFw Tool 4.9 is a powerful utility designed for Samsung Android devices. Its primary function is to effortlessly remove Factory Reset Protection (FRP) lock with a single click. The tool also provides a one-click solution for changing the CSC (Consumer Software Customization) code, allowing you to customize your device's region and software features. This version includes enhanced support for new security models, offering a reliable and user-friendly solution for managing your Samsung device's software restrictions and unlocking its full potential.
Features
- One-click FRP lock removal.
- One-click CSC code change.
- Support for new Samsung security models.
- Simple and intuitive user interface.
